
Perturbation theory in chemistry
Perturbation theory in chemistry is a method used to estimate how a small change in a system affects its overall energy or behavior. It's like starting with a well-understood problem and then adding a slight modification, allowing scientists to predict complex interactions—such as electron interactions within molecules—without solving the entire problem from scratch. This approach simplifies calculations of molecular properties by considering the effect of these small "perturbations," helping chemists understand and predict chemical behavior more efficiently.
